Q: Is 82,806 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 82,806 is a composite number.

Why is 82,806 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 82,806 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 37 74 111 222 373 746 1,119 2,238 13,801 27,602 41,403 and 82,806, with no remainder.

Since 82,806 cannot be divided by just 1 and 82,806, it is a composite number.
